titleOfInvention | Radiation heat dissipation film element for integrated circuit |
abstract | The application discloses a radiation heat dissipation film element for an integrated circuit, which comprises a release film layer, a heat conduction silica gel layer, a radiation heat dissipation layer and a Polyimide (PI) film layer which are sequentially laminated from bottom to top; the radiation heat dissipation layer is formed by bonding acetate fibers/nano silicon dioxide particles, and redundant heat of the main body is removed by heat radiation to the outside, so that the effect of cooling and heat dissipation is achieved. The utility model has scientific and reasonable structure, the heat-conducting silica gel sheet layer is closely contacted with the device to be cooled, so that the heat conduction is smoother and quicker; the radiation heat dissipation layer removes redundant heat of the main body by carrying out heat radiation to the outside, so that the effect of cooling and heat dissipation is realized; the utility model discloses nontoxic green accords with current energy saving and emission reduction's demand, and preparation simple process is with low costs in addition, has efficient heat dissipation cooling effect. |
